Transaction 59af76a3dce86a08c418d3c5648bf8549f11a604fe882af2b2ab04376bd87a00

4 Input
1 Outputs
  • 59af76a3dce86a08c418d3c5648bf8549f11a604fe882af2b2ab04376bd87a00:0
  • value  1838100
    address  1k7HKSqGHnu3MSPDa3V4SWomiFEG5xWzh